Unique Challenges in Water & Wastewater Infrastructure

Municipal water and wastewater systems face distinct operational challenges requiring specialized solutions

Aging Infrastructure

Many water mains are 50-100 years old, with some exceeding their designed lifespan. Corrosion, soil stress, and material degradation create ongoing leak risks that require continuous monitoring.

Non-Revenue Water

Water utilities lose significant revenue through leaks, meter inaccuracies, and unauthorized consumption. Reducing non-revenue water (NRW) is a critical operational and financial priority.

Wastewater Overflows

Sanitary sewer overflows (SSOs) and combined sewer overflows (CSOs) create environmental hazards, regulatory violations, and public health concerns. Early detection prevents costly cleanups.

Limited Budgets & Resources

Municipalities operate with constrained budgets and limited technical staff. Cost-effective monitoring solutions that integrate with existing SCADA systems provide maximum value.

Applications Across Water & Wastewater Systems

Water Distribution

Municipal drinking water networks delivering safe water to homes and businesses. Monitor for leaks, main breaks, and water quality issues across thousands of miles of pipe.

Wastewater Collection

Sanitary sewer systems collecting wastewater from residential and commercial customers. Detect blockages, overflows, and infiltration from groundwater.

Combined Sewer Systems

Older systems that combine stormwater and wastewater. Monitor overflow events and optimize storage capacity during heavy rainfall.

Reclaimed Water

Purple-pipe systems delivering treated wastewater for irrigation and industrial use. Ensure product quality and prevent cross-connections with potable water.
